Five years ago I organised a French meetup in Milton Keynes with the help of a dear friend.
The main subject was to show unity after the attack on Charlie Hebdo in Paris.
The attendees, who represented many nationalities all contributed to decorating a canvas to express thier unity against this attack against free speech.
This banner was later given to The Milton Keynes News and mkweb who published a photo and a short article on 21st January 2015 – still viewable online thanks to the Internet Archive.
